Can An Elementary School Teacher Afford Rent in Pascagoula, MS?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 25.8% of gross income.

Pascagoula r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Mississippi state estimate).

Pascagoula median rent
$1,166/mo
Elementary School Teacher salary (Mississippi)
$54,335/yr
Rent as % of income
25.8%
Gross monthly income works out to about $4,528,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,358/mo in rent. Pascagoula's median rent of $1,166 leaves roughly $192/mo of headroom under that threshold. An elementary school teacher works roughly 44.6 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and an elementary school teacher salary

Teacher affordability is one of the sharpest local-rent lenses available, because public-school pay scales are set by state and district while rent is set by local market conditions. The result is that two teachers with identical credentials can face very different rent burdens depending on where they teach. At the national-average teacher salary, the 30% rule supports about $1,677 a month in rent — comfortable in most of the Midwest and South, tight in mid-cost cities, and out of reach without roommates in the most expensive coastal markets.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Mississippi state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Pascagoula, MS.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
